If you’ve ever thought about strapping on a pair of snowshoes, the Tacoma REI store has a program for you.
Snowshoeing is a good way to experience the beauty of the Northwest during the winter, and there are plenty of places to go in Western Washington.

Participants in the free session will learn about the initial skills needed to get on the trails, what gear will make snowshoeing comfortable and fun, and good places to go to get started.

Later this winter, snowshoe treks will be offered at Mount Rainier National Park and in the Snoqualmie Summit area in the Mount Baker-Snoqualmie National Forest.

If you are new to the sport, renting snowshoes would be a good option. A number of South Sound businesses offer rentals.

The class will begin at 7 p.m. Tuesday. The store is located at 3825 S. Steele St., Tacoma.
